本帖最后由 20161001 于 2018-7-6 14:13 编辑
测试平台环境:F767 + SDRAM(16bit) + 7寸RGB(1024x600)电容触摸屏幕+stemwin
驱动接口硬件是RGB888,实际软件方式是RGB565。
在测试stemwin的时候
无意间发现在
6点钟方向视角的时候可以看到好像有拖尾背景 {MOD}?这个背景 {MOD}好像应该和左侧的图案颜 {MOD}有关系?也就是我方框框起来的的颜 {MOD}好像和左侧的那个鹦鹉和狗的图片颜 {MOD}有关系,拖尾背景 {MOD}宽度和左侧对应的鹦鹉和狗的图片宽度大概相同。
给我的感觉好像一行一行从上往下,从左往右扫描的时候左边的图片最后的像素颜 {MOD}被刷到了右侧一样?
可能的原因:
1,硬件电路板原因(硬件是自己做的,原理图纸参考开发板的图纸做修改,一版就点亮了)
2,软件代码本身原因(感觉应该不是。因为其他例子没有这种情况)?
3,屏幕质量差瑕疵品?
4,屏幕本身坏了(屏幕是用海绵胶粘在电路板上的,中间有拆掉过几次,因为海绵胶粘性较大,拆的时候屏幕背面金属铁皮屏蔽板有点变形,会不会屏幕被我掰坏了?不过感觉应该不是这个原因?)?
最后还有一个疑问,屏幕和F767硬件接口是RGB888,但是软件是RGB565,那么多余的引脚怎么处理,软件上面把多余的引脚强制置0或者1吗(我实测全部置0或者1都效果都一样,)。
手机拍摄看的可能不是特别明显,实际肉眼看要比图片稍微明显。症状表现在红 {MOD}箭头所指右侧方框区域有拖影颜 {MOD}。
下面这张上是上面这张图的原图。
下面这张是垂直视角偏向于12点方向视角。也会有点但不是还特别明显。有拖尾的情况主要是6点钟视角很明显。垂直看不明显。
测试其他例子包括纯颜 {MOD}刷屏(各种颜 {MOD}清屏刷屏),没有发现这个情况。
另外这种RGB屏并不像MCU屏那样初始化的时候还需要写一堆命发送给屏幕。
例子里都是直接简单的直接设置下时钟速率等参数就完事儿了。
那这样应该可以排除是屏幕驱动初始化问题。
我在想,难道是因为RGB565的原因导致过渡效果的时候出现异常偏 {MOD}?
一周热门 更多>